フラグメントでリストビューを使用する方法はありますか? ViewPager を使用してフラグメント間をスワイプしています (これに続いて: http://thepseudocoder.wordpress.com/2011/10/05/android-page-swiping-using-viewpager/ )。かなりうまく機能しますが、各フラグメントのリストビューのように。問題は を使用する必要があることですが、Android 2.2 を搭載したデバイスでアプリを実行し、 3.0 以降でのみListFragment
動作できるようにしたいのです。ListFragments
後でこのリストビューをカスタマイズするので、実際に 2.2 で動作するフラグメントでリストビューを使用するにはどうすればよいでしょうか? 前もって感謝します!
1 に答える
3
問題は、ListFragment を使用する必要があることですが、アプリを Android 2.2 のデバイスで実行できるようにしたいのですが、ListFragments は 3.0 以降でしか機能しません。
正しくない。
昨日書いたように、フラグメントシステムには 2 つの実装があります。
1 つは API レベル 11 にネイティブです。これのListFragment
実装はandroid.app.ListFragment
であり、通常の とともに使用しますActivity
。
1 つは Android サポート パッケージからのものです。FragmentActivity
API レベル 4 までさかのぼって機能します。そのためには、バックポートのバージョンのクラスを継承して使用しFragment
ます (ほとんどの場合、 のandroid.support.v4.app
代わりにを使用します
。ドキュメントで。android.app
ListFragment
android.support.v4.app.ListFragment
于 2013-01-05T14:41:27.387 に答える